         <description><![CDATA[<div>There exists divided opinions on whether students should be given homework. Whereas some people argue against its importance, I concur that this practice is an essential part of education.<br><br>On the one hand, there are several reasons why people argue that homework is an unnecessary burden on children. First and foremost, they believe that giving homework does not enhance the educational outcome since academic performance solely based on children's aptitude. In Finland, for example, where schoolwork is not compulsory, students often have top-tier results compared to countries with setting the homework is the norm. Secondly, they argue that homework might lead to stress and mental illness since the school day is already long. Hence, the further heavy workload would place such a burden on children, leaving them no time for other leisure activities.&nbsp;<br><br>Nevertheless, I would still argue that homework has an vital role to play in educating youngsters. The primary benefit is that it encourages their problem-solving skills as well as independent learning, as they have to finish tasks at their own pace. Another advantage is that valuable lessons will be ingrained more in students' understanding. Take history for example, they would have to make deep researches into their ancestor's past; thereby teaching them to be well-aware of the national identity and traditional values.&nbsp;<br><br>In conclusion, homework certainly have some downsides but I believe that its benefit outweigh them in the long term</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>The setting of home assignment has been a thorny issue that frequently generates a great deal of heated debate. While many believe that it would be better for schooling children not to be assigned homework, I personally believe that these home study tasks have a vital role to play in the education process of students.</div><div>&nbsp;<br><br></div><div>On the one hand, there is a wide range of reasons why many argue that children should not be burdened with homework. Along with the social development is the longer school day as well as the heavier workload that the children have to handle at school. This seems to leave these students inadequate time for engaging in extra-curriculum and physical activities, which are as pivotal as learning in their development process. Additionally, it is evident in many countries that home assignment makes no contribution to educational outcome improvement. By way of illustration, although students in Finland are not assigned home study tasks by their educators, this nation still frequently tops international educational league tables.<br><br></div><div>On the other hand, it is an irrefutable fact that home assignments are inextricably linked with educational enhancement. Being given homework urges children to take more responsibility, encouraging independent learning and problem-solving. By handling tasks alone, students are able to revise the lessons at school and consolidate their knowledge. For instance, to solve such English exercises as writing an essay, students apply the structures and vocabulary taught by their instructors. Furthermore, students can acquire advanced study skills through this process, which feasibly results in high academic performances and even enables them to get more medals and prizes for academic achievements.&nbsp;<br><br></div><div>In conclusion, I would contend that the setting of homework is an indispensable factor in students’ educational development, which plays an essential role in their future lives. However, the load of assignments should be reasonable as the balance between study and relax time is equally important.<br><br></div><div>&nbsp;<br><br></div>]]></description>
